Brick Hardscaping in Providence, RI
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design and installation of durable, visually appealing features made from brick materials to enhance outdoor spaces. Common projects include constructing patios, walkways, retaining walls, garden borders, and outdoor fireplaces. Homeowners interested in brick hardscaping often want to understand the different types of brick options available, the durability of the materials, and how these features can complement the overall landscape design. It’s also helpful to consider the maintenance requirements and how brick features can add value and functionality to a property.
Before requesting brick hardscaping services, property owners should think about their specific goals for the outdoor space, such as creating a functional patio area or defining garden boundaries. They may also want to consider the style and color of bricks that match their aesthetic preferences, as well as any structural considerations like drainage or soil stability. Understanding these details can help ensure that the finished hardscape meets both practical needs and visual expectations.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ick Patios - create durable and attractive outdoor surfaces for entertaining and relaxation.
Brick Walkways - provide safe, functional pathways that enhance curb appeal.
Retaining Walls - stabilize slopes and add visual interest to landscape designs.
Fireplace and Fire Pit Installations - add warmth and ambiance to outdoor living areas.
Brick Steps and Staircases - improve accessibility and complement existing landscape features.
Driveway Borders and Edging - define driveways and garden beds with sturdy brick accents.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as that add durability and classic style to a property.
How long does brick hardscaping typically last? When properly installed and maintained, brick hardscaping can last for decades, providing long-lasting functionality and appearance.
What are common design options for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ping offers various patterns, colors, and layouts to complement different architectural styles and landscape designs.
Is brick hardscaping suitable for uneven or sloped terrain? Yes, brick can be used to create level surfaces and retaining walls that adapt to uneven or sloped areas effectively.
